Ardnamurchan 6yo 2019/2026
#24, The Heart Cut
Single malt - Western Highlands
Orange gold
52% ABV
Dram
Nose: Cedar, olive brine, smoke, peat, germolene, popcorn, honey, hints of dried apricots. With water, honey, dried apricots, magic marker.
Mouthfeel: Light body, volatile, cool, astringent.
Tasting: Sour salty. Cedar, popcorn, smoke, peat, germolene, lemon zest, grapefruit, hints of gentian. With water, honey, dried apricots, pears, germolene.
Finish: Medium. Grapefruit, gentian, popcorn, smoke.
Comments:
Quite a smoky whisky as Ardnamurchan goes. Lots of bitter citrus alongside all that smoke and peat. Water opens up a fruitiness that is quite intense, dried apricots are especially prominent.
Verdict:
I like this a lot.

New Riff 4yo 2021/2025
New Riff 4yo 2021/2025
#22, The Heart Cut
Single bourbon - Kentucky
Amber brown
52% ABV
Dram
Nose: Walnuts, toffee, coffee, molasses, cough mixture, cherries. With water, walnuts, toffee, molasses.
Mouthfeel: Medium body, hot, volatile, astringent.
Tasting: Sweet salty. Mint, cherries, cough mixture, blackcurrant cordial, walnuts, marmalade, hints of coffee. With water, cherries, vanilla, cough mixture, popcorn.
Finish: Medium. Cough mixture, walnuts, cherries, marmalade.
Comments:
Love me a new Heart Cut when they come out. This one is like walnut praline, with lots of mint and cough mixture on the tongue. It’s quite intense, not much of the brown paper note that so many bourbons have.
Verdict:
I like this.

Thomson 5yo 2019/2025 (NZ Pinot Noir Cask)
Thomson 5yo 2019/2025 (NZ Pinot Noir Cask)
#19, The Heart Cut
Single malt - Auckland
Reddish pink
51.5% ABV
Dram
Nose: Strawberry jam, figs, toast, blackcurrant cordial, damson jam, honey, butter, hints of new plastic. With water, strawberry jam, honey, figs.
Mouthfeel: Medium body, volatile, expands, turns airy.
Tasting: Bitter sweet. Vanilla, honey, strawberry jam, figs, damson jam, toast, white pepper, cloves, nutmeg. With water, strawberry jam, red wine, nutmeg.
Finish: Medium. Honey, damson jam, toast, white pepper, cloves.
Comments:
This is among the better red wine finishes I’ve had. Lots of sweet red fruit notes, with toast and spices. Water brings out more jammy notes and something even sweeter. Rather delicious.
Verdict:
I like this a lot.

Thomson 5yo 2019/2025 (Bourbon Cask)
Thomson 5yo 2019/2025 (Bourbon Cask)
#18, The Heart Cut
Single malt - Auckland
Golden orange
50.8% ABV
Dram
Nose: Charcoal ash, tyre rubber, canned pineapples, lemon zest, sandalwood, honey, black pepper. With water, canned pineapples, honey, sandalwood, hints of apricots.
Mouthfeel: Heavy body, oily, turns syrupy, mouth coating.
Tasting: Bitter. Charcoal ash, driftwood smoke, malted grains, tyre rubber, lemon zest, apricots, sandalwood. With water, lemon zest, vanilla, roast beef, soot.
Finish: Medium. Charcoal ash, malted grains, driftwood smoke, soot.
Comments:
A very interesting nose, combined with a bitter ashy flavour on the tongue. It’s not intense smoke though, in fact it’s rather gentle, but the ashiness is quite pronounced. I do like canned pineapples, but this isn’t quite rhe barbecued pineapple, more heavily smoked in the tail end of a barbecue.
Verdict:
I like this.

Lochlea 5yo 2019/2025
Lochlea 5yo 2019/2025
#17, The Heart Cut
Single malt - Lowlands
Pale green gold
54% ABV
Dram
Nose: Smoke, green apples, honey, limes, lemon zest, malted grains, hints of peat. With water, limes, lemon zest, cinder toffee, toast.
Mouthfeel: Heavy body, syrupy, loosens slightly, warm.
Tasting: Bitter sour. Limes, green apples, lemon zest, sourdough bread, malted grains, smoke, hints of charcoal ash. With water, sweeter, honey, toast, green apples, cinder toffee.
Finish: Short. Smoke, charcoal ash, limes, green apples, sourdough bread.
Comments:
Quite tart and fruity. It’s an ex Islay cask, so the peat is gentle and light. Lots of bready notes underneath that sour fruit as well. Rather good, as all the Heart Cut bottlings are.
Verdict:
I like this a lot.

Starward 5yo 2019/2024
Starward 5yo 2019/2024
#14, The Heart Cut
Single malt - Victoria
Red
55% ABV
Dram
Nose: Chocolate, raisins, strawberry jam, magic marker, fresh baked bread, vanilla, white pepper. With water, strawberry jam, raisins, chocolate, hints of golden syrup.
Mouthfeel: Light body, volatile, loosens, hot.
Tasting: Sweet sour. Strawberry jam, blackcurrant cordial, white pepper, fresh baked bread, raisins, apricot jam, hints of marzipan, hints of brown butter. With water, raisins, marzipan, golden syrup, hints of brown butter.
Finish: Long. Strawberry jam, magic marker, marzipan, white pepper, blackcurrant cordial.
Comments:
Another red wine cask with high ABV, lots of fruit notes, but here it’s deeper, with flavours of butter and nuts. It takes water well, the buttery notes become more forward and intense. Very nice indeed.
Verdict:
I like this a lot.

Starward 6yo 2018/2024
Starward 6yo 2018/2024
#15, The Heart Cut
Single malt - Victoria
Red
54% ABV
Dram
Nose: Strawberry laces, cherry blossom, fresh baked bread, lemon zest, black pepper, hints of raspberry jam. With water, malted grains, black pepper, cherry blossom.
Mouthfeel: Light body, loosens, expands, volatile.
Tasting: Sweet sour. Lemon zest, blackcurrant cordial, cherry blossom, vanilla, cola nuts, fresh baked bread, mint, hints of raspberry jam. With water, blackcurrant cordial, black pepper, hints of coffee.
Finish: Medium. Blackcurrant cordial, raspberry jam, strawberry laces, cherry blossom, mint.
Comments:
High ABV red wine cask, usually a recipe for disaster but in this case, it makes a very floral sweet whisky. Lots of interaction between the wood and the spirit, creating fruity and vanilla notes. Complex and layered.
Verdict:
I like this.

JJ Corry Irish Whiskey
JJ Corry Irish Whiskey
#11, The Heart Cut
Blended malt
Dark gold
48% ABV
Dram
Nose: Strawberry jam, apricots, vanilla, raisins, copper pipes, aluminium foil, black tea. With water, strawberry jam, cream, shortcrust pastry.
Mouthfeel: Medium body, loosens, expands, warm.
Tasting: Bitter sweet. Aluminium foil, copper pipes, chocolate, black tea, raisins, apricot jam. With water, strawberry jam, shortcrust pastry, cream, brown paper.
Finish: Medium. Black tea, sandalwood, apricot jam, aluminium foil.
Comments:
Four casks blended together, one of which is a pajarette cask (a first for me). It’s not a sherry bomb though, it’s delicate and complex, with plenty of feinty notes that prickle the nose. Lovely stuff.
Verdict:
I like this a lot.

St George Spirits 7yo 2016/2023 (New American Oak Cask)
St George Spirits 7yo 2016/2023 (New American Oak Cask)
#9, The Heart Cut
Single malt - California
Dark gold
52.5% ABV
Dram
Nose: Pear drops, jalapeños, malt vinegar, malted grains, chillies, fresh cut grass, white pepper, hints of fresh baked bread.
Mouthfeel: Medium body, astringent, tingly, warm.
Tasting: Bitter sour. Pear drops, jalapeños, fresh baked bread, white pepper, cinnamon, nopales, hints of chillies.
Finish: Medium. Fresh cut grass, white pepper, malted grains, malt vinegar.
Comments:
A very unusual, vegetal whisky. Jalapeños are very unusual in whisky in my experience, they might even be unique to this whisky. It’s almost like hot sauce, and I’d absolutely eat this sprinkled over a steak. Smooth and quite delicious.
Verdict:
I like this a lot.

Stauning 5yo 2017/2022
Stauning 5yo 2017/2022
#1, The Heart Cut
Single malt - Midtjylland
Dark yellow
52% ABV
Dram
Nose: Raisins, blackberry jam, driftwood smoke, orange peel, golden syrup, black pepper, camphor. With water, fresh cut grass, camphor, driftwood smoke.
Mouthfeel: Medium body, astringent, cool, tingly.
Tasting: Bitter sweet. Brown paper, black pepper, camphor, raisins, rye bread, golden syrup, coriander, hints of driftwood smoke. With water, camphor, black tea, black pepper, rye bread.
Finish: Medium. Black pepper, coriander, camphor, hints of blackberry jam.
Comments:
Slightly smoky, jammy sweet Stauning. There’s a rye bread note, but the label says single malt, which is interesting. I don’t think they’re as strict in Denmark as in Scotland.
Verdict:
I like this a lot.
